| 表面の説明 | A fully rendered lion in profile facing right, standing on a grassy ground, occupies the central field. The country name REPUBLIQUE DEMOCRATIQUE DU CONGO arcs along the upper periphery in raised Latin lettering, all within a beaded border. The denomination 100 FRANCS appears in the lower field beneath the lion. The overall design is struck in high relief with a polished proof finish. |

The Democratic Republic of Congo has issued a long and somewhat chaotic series of wildlife-themed gold and silver pieces through the early 2000s, many produced by foreign minting houses and distributed almost entirely through the European collector market rather than through any domestic channel. This kingfisher piece falls squarely within that output — a collector bullion item with negligible connection to Congolese monetary circulation.
KM#154 is documented but mintage figures for this series are notoriously unreliable in the published literature.
